LRI Investments's Q3 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2025, LRI Investments held 1,372 positions worth $1.22B, up 3.8% from $1.18B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 59% of the portfolio.

LRI Investments deployed $71.8M of net new capital in Q3 2025, opening 107 new positions and adding to 266 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Comerica: 1,450 shares worth $99.4K.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 36% of assets, down from 40%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Industrials.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was JPMorgan Active Value ETF, an estimated $930K trimmed.
